  Ratings distributionRatings distribution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AV
where: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.

Rating metrics: Outliers can be removed when calculating a mean average to dampen the effects of ratings outside the normal distribution. This figure is provided as the trimmed mean. A high standard deviation can be legitimate, but can sometimes indicate 'gaming' is occurring. Consider a simplified example* of an item receiving ratings of 100, 50, & 0. The mean average rating would be 50. However, ratings of 55, 50 & 45 could also result in the same average. The second average might be more trusted because there is more consensus around a particular rating (a lower deviation).
(*In practice, some albums can have several thousand ratings)

This album is rated in the top 1% of all albums on BestEverAlbums.com. This album has a Bayesian average rating of 80.2/100, a mean average of 79.7/100, and a trimmed mean (excluding outliers) of 80.3/100. The standard deviation for this album is 12.0.

The guitar work on here is simply phenomenal and it really blows you away every time you hear it. That is the main selling point for this record as it is made the centrepiece for the music and everything else seems weak in comparison to it. Songs like Jingo, Persuasion and Evil Ways best display his quality and they are the songs that drag me back to this album every time. The percussion does have some great moments as well and the piano work on Treat is simply sublime. However, the rest of the instrumentation could be better and it sounds a bit plain. A few songs don't really hit for me as well and I find myself switching off during those tracks. Overall, if you want an example of a true genius on a guitar this is a brilliant album for you and while the rest of the instruments are still decent they just fade into the background in comparison, which holds the record back for me as it could be built upon better. It is still a great record though and deserves a lot of praise.
